About the job

Core Developer is responsible for supporting Google's Developer Languages, Developer Frameworks, and services that support Google's Developer Lifecycle. Developer's mission is to make it easy for all developers to improve the world by creating fast, high-quality, and trustworthy experiences with the best technology from Google and the open source ecosystem. DevAI is an important company-wide initiative that has been responsible for over 10% coding velocity gains and more than 30% of the code authored by AI. This program is now at the forefront of bringing Agentic AI to a broad spectrum of Software Development across Google.

The work in our organization spans training and fine tuning Gemini models, deploying them via Google's commercial AI platforms (e.g., Gemini API, Vertex AI), integrating them into all the developer surfaces, and building new AI native experiences. We partner closely with Google DeepMind and Google Cloud organizations across a broad range of efforts.

Our existing and in-flight efforts are materially improving key Software Engineer journeys and delivering measurable productivity and velocity gains through state of the art enterprise-grade AI.

In this role, you will be responsible for defining the technical roadmap for improving Agentic AI quality outcomes, driving AI adoption, and guiding key workstreams around building cutting-edge capabilities that address software engineering modernization at Google-scale. You will drive the technical vision and execution of our Developer AI Strategy, ensuring alignment with broader company goals.
